To change a rear window on a Renault Megane, first, ensure you have the correct replacement glass. Remove any trim or covers around the window, using a trim removal tool if necessary. Carefully detach the old window by cutting through the adhesive with a glass cutter or utility knife. Once removed, clean the surface, apply new adhesive, and install the new window, securing it in place and allowing it to cure as per the adhesive manufacturer's instructions.

How do you fix the rear electric window in Renault megane?

To fix the rear electric window in a Renault Megane, first, check the fuse related to the window mechanism and replace it if necessary. If the fuse is intact, inspect the window switch and the wiring for any damage or loose connections. If those components are functioning correctly, the issue may lie with the window motor or regulator, which may require replacement. For safety and proper handling, consider consulting a professional mechanic if you're unsure.

How do you replace back wiper on Renault megane?

To replace the back wiper on a Renault Megane, first lift the wiper arm away from the rear window. Press the release tab on the wiper blade holder to detach the old blade. Align the new wiper blade with the holder and push it into place until you hear a click. Finally, lower the wiper arm back onto the window, ensuring it sits properly.
